Hosts Elizabeth Urban and Sandra Esparza could go on and on about any topic, from politics to the latest movies. On their podcast 'Tea Time,' they cover weekly topics that change depending on school, the season or even their moods. In this episode, they talk about recent court cases and their thoughts on the U.S. justice system. With so many high-profile court cases happening currently, Elizabeth and Sandra offer their thoughts on what police, politicians, judges and even regular citizens could be doing to help make the system equitable. They also touch on the wealth gap, offering their thoughts on what the top 1% should be doing with their earnings.
